有砟轨道技术在北京市城市轨道交通地下线正线的应用研究

摘    要:研究分析北京市城市轨道交通地下线正线应用有砟轨道结构技术措施。对地下线正线应用有砟轨道的结构形式、部件选型进行设计分析,并辅以模拟计算手段对道床部分典型动力特性进行分析,借鉴国铁养护维修典型年运量理论对地下线有砟轨道养护维修工作量进行分析,认为道床几何尺寸、纵横阻力等稳定性指标能够满足相关规范要求,设备选型合理可行,养护维修工作量适中,认为北京市城市轨道交通地下线正线应用有砟轨道技术具备可行性和重要意义。

关 键 词:城市轨道交通  有砟轨道  养护维修  道床阻力

Study on Ballast Track Technology Applied to Main Track of Beijing Urban Rail Transit

Abstract:Research and analysis are conducted of the ballast track technology applied to the main track of Beijing urban rail transit system. Track form,equipment selection,and typical dynamic performance related to the underground main line are analyzed by means of simulation and the maintenance workload of ballast track is analyzed in terms of railway system annual traffic volume. The results show that the ballast track geometric dimension and ballast resistance meet the specifications,the equipment selection is reasonable and feasible,the maintenance workload is moderate,and the ballast track technology is applicable for the main track of urban rail transit system.
Keywords:Urban rail transit  Ballast track  Maintenance  Ballast bed resistance
